Vacating Term time Campus Accommodation 2015/16
Vacating your roomWe have received confirmation from the Residence Office that you vacated your accommodation. The latest you had to vacate your room was 10am the morning of the tenancy end-date stated in the Licence Agreement. If you chose to vacate early you will not be refunded for any additional nights you paid for as the charges until the end of the contract apply. As per regulation 17.5 if a resident terminates their Licence Agreement after 10.00 am on 23 February 2015 (Undergraduate, Language and PGCert length contracts) then, instead of a fee of £350 (£400 for studio flats), the amount charged to their account will be the full rent until the end of the Licence period. The keys should have been returned to your Residences Office. Should the Residence Team find any issues with your room and/or they have not received the keys they will be in contact with you directly and advise if there are any extra charges. Outstanding moneyIf you have any outstanding fines, charges or administration fees on your account you are required to pay them by cash, cheque or credit/debit card to the Cash Office located in the Bannerman Centre or by telephone on +44(0)1895 265264. Any outstanding money should be paid within 7 days of returning your keys and will be subject to late payment fees if left unpaid. Refund of any accommodation creditIf you would like to request a refund of an accommodation related overpayment on your account please complete the online request form. The Accommodation Office will check to see if you are due a refund and will authorise the Finance Office to process this. The Finance Office will process the refund subject to any other money outstanding on your account. This process usually takes up to 3 weeks. If you still have not received the refund after this period then Brunel/LBIC students can contact the Student Centre by telephone on +44(0)1895 268268 or by email at student.centre@brunel.ac.uk to check on progress.
